The brief

The Authority wishes to award a framework agreement for Fixed Electrical Inspection and Testing and Portable Appliance Testing to Properties within the County of North Yorkshire and surrounding Council Authority Areas.

This framework contract is to provide Planned Preventative Maintenance (PPM) Service Visits and Planned Repairs Works to ensure that all Fixed Electrical Installations, Portable Appliances and Stage Lighting Installations under this agreement meet all statutory safety requirements and are maintained appropriately.

Work must be carried out in accordance with appropriate British Standards, Approved Codes of Practice and Manufactures specifications also in accordance with best practice as determined by a recognised trade body – for example, NICEIC, ECA or NAPIT.
